Book excerpt: Janice Pennington of the game show "The Price is Right" tells her story of the disappearance of her husband, Fritz Stammberger along the Russian, Afghanistan, and Pakistan borders. In a search that lasted 17 years, the author tries to discover the fate of her missing husband.

Book excerpt: The gripping memoir of one critical year in the life of Ann Davidson and her husband, Julian, a prominent physiology professor at Stanford Medical School who has Alzheimer's disease. These 56 vignettes each tell a complete story, progressing from Ann and Julian's initial confusion and anger through adjustments and moments of humor and joy to increasing acceptance and an odd sort of peace.
